To make my plots clear in greyscale, I'm using symbols and I want these to appear on the legend as well as the line colour. Does anyone know how to do this?
    plot(IPA5a(end-1000:end,1)*10^-6, IPA5a(end-1000:end,3)*10^9,'Color','g','LineWidth',1)
    hold on
    plot(IPA5a(end-1000:20:end,1)*10^-6, IPA5a(end-1000:20:end,3)*10^9,'<','Color','g')
    legend({'IPA'},'Location','southeast')

        Is this what you are looking for using this symbol '<'  ?
n = 2000; 
IPA5a = [linspace(0, 2*pi, n)' sin(linspace(0, 2*pi, n))'];
% Plotting the continuous line
p1 = plot(IPA5a(end-1000:end,1)*10^-6, IPA5a(end-1000:end,2)*10^9, ...
    'Color','k', 'LineWidth',1, 'LineStyle','-'); % 'k' for black
hold on
% Overlaying the markers
p2 = plot(IPA5a(end-1000:20:end,1)*10^-6, IPA5a(end-1000:20:end,2)*10^9, ...
    '<', 'Color','k', 'MarkerFaceColor','k');
% Adding the legend to reflect both line and marker
legend([p1, p2], {'IPA Line', 'IPA Marker'}, 'Location', 'southeast');
hold off

        The code plots two lines, however has only one legend entry, so the second series (with the '<' marker) does not show up in the legend.  Use '<g' to plot the markers, or '<-g' to plot the markers with a line linking them.  That aside, both lines are the  same colours, so that may make them a bit difficult to distinguish.  
IPA5a = rand(2000,3)+[0 1 2]+1E10;
IPA5a(:,1) = sort(IPA5a(:,1));
    figure
    plot(IPA5a(end-1000:end,1)*10^-6, IPA5a(end-1000:end,3)*10^9,'Color','g','LineWidth',1)
    hold on
    plot(IPA5a(end-1000:20:end,1)*10^-6, IPA5a(end-1000:20:end,3)*10^9,'<g')
    legend({'IPA','IPA<'},'Location','southeast')
